Letter to the Editor -- Another Reason to Vote Yes on Proposition PFK (Progress for Kids)

Here is another reason to vote yes on Proposition PFK.  The school can take advantage of the windmill funds for approximately 20 years. This provides a good opportunity to make upgrades and expansions to the school district using the proposed bond levy along with the windmill funds. The windmill funds may no longer be available after 20 years, so making the proposed updates now would be a wise choice.

Many buildings in Hopkins and Pickering have been lost due to age and neglect. We cannot afford to neglect our schools.  By voting yes on Proposition PFK, the school district will be able to update both buildings in Pickering and Hopkins. This will  make our schools and communities more appealing to new community members and students and would be helpful because open enrollment could be a real possibility in the near future.

I hope you agree with me and vote yes on Proposition PFK.
